I photographed this Cracker Butterfly at the Magic Wings Butterfly Garden in South Deerfield, Massachusetts late in September. If you love butterflies like I do than you will have to visit Magic Wings when you are in the New England area. It is the largest indoor butterfly garden and conservatory featuring gorgeous tropical plants, an indoor pond with a water fall, with 100's of butterflies from all over the world.

Fun Facts: Hamadryas is a species of cracker butterfly. The butterflies are commonly known as Crackers due to the ability of the males of several species to produce a sound similar to the crackling of bacon in a frying pan. There are 20 members of the genus Hamadryas. Most are found only in Central and South America. In several species the ground color is greyish and the pattern acts as an extremely effective camouflage against the bark of trees. In others such as amphinome, laodamia and velutina the wings are velvety black with a blue sheen and a pattern of bright blue spots.
